Skills and experience required for Security Analyst for SOC-L1

A Security Analyst for SOC-L1 (Security Operations Center – Level 1) typically requires the following skills and experience:

A security analyst for SOC-L1 must have a basic understanding of networking and security concepts, such as TCP/IP, firewalls, intrusion detection and prevention, and VPNs.

A security analyst for SOC-L1 should have familiarity with commonly used security tools, such as SIEM, IDS/IPS, vulnerability scanners, and packet captures.

A security analyst for SOC-L1 should have a good understanding of operating systems such as Windows, Unix, and Linux.

A security analyst for SOC-L1 must have a good understanding of security incidents and be able to identify and respond to them.

A security analyst for SOC-L1 should have excellent analytical and problem-solving skills to identify and analyze security threats and incidents.

A security analyst for SOC-L1 must be able to communicate effectively with team members, management, and external stakeholders.

A security analyst for SOC-L1 must have an understanding of compliance standards, such as PCI-DSS, HIPAA, and SOX.

Having relevant certifications like CompTIA Security+, GIAC, or Certified Ethical Hacker (CEH) would be an added advantage.
